C++: Reduce FPs by excluding all commas in loop heads

This leads to a 50% reduction of alerts in MRVA 1000.

predicate isInLoopHead(CommaExpr ce) {
ce.getParent*() = [any(Loop l).getCondition(), any(ForStmt f).getUpdate()]
or
ce.getEnclosingStmt() = any(ForStmt f).getInitialization()
}
from CommaExpr ce, Expr left, Expr right, Location leftLoc, Location rightLoc
where
ce.fromSource() and
@@ -28,6 +34,7 @@ where
right = normalizeExpr(ce.getRightOperand()) and
leftLoc = left.getLocation() and
rightLoc = right.getLocation() and
not isInLoopHead(ce) and // HACK to reduce FPs in loop heads; assumption: unlikely to be misread due to '(', ')' delimiters
leftLoc.getEndLine() < rightLoc.getStartLine() and
leftLoc.getStartColumn() > rightLoc.getStartColumn()
select right, "The indentation level after the comma can be misleading (for some tab sizes)."
select right, "The indentation after the comma may be misleading (for some tab sizes)."
